#c42544 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c42544 is composed of 76.9% red, 14.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 348.3 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 45.7%. #c42544 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a88 with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c42544 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c42544 has RGB values of R:196, G:37,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.65,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12854596.

Hex triplet c42544 #c42544
RGB Decimal 196, 37, 68 rgb(196,37,68)
RGB Percent 76.9, 14.5, 26.7 rgb(76.9%,14.5%,26.7%)
CMYK 0, 81, 65, 23
HSL 348.3°, 68.2, 45.7 hsl(348.3,68.2%,45.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 348.3°, 81.1, 76.9
Web Safe cc3333 #cc3333
CIE-LAB 43.477, 61.719, 23.267
XYZ 24.471, 13.479, 6.782
xyY 0.547, 0.301, 13.479
CIE-LCH 43.477, 65.959, 20.656
CIE-LUV 43.477, 112.16, 12.886
Hunter-Lab 36.714, 54.726, 14.748
Binary 11000100, 00100101, 01000100

Shades and Tints of #c42544

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0305 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c42544

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6d70 is the less saturated color, while #e8012e is the most saturated one.
